Some healthcare insurance policies have a threshold that must be met prior to they can cover certain healthcare expenses, like visits to psychiatrists. The deductible may differ based on the plan, so be sure to review your policy to determine how you'll have to pay for each session. Additionally, some insurers will only cover a particular number of psychiatric appointments each month or throughout the year. If you don't meet the required number of sessions, the entire cost will be billed for each visit.

Psychiatrists may not always be available to new and existing patients, due to the shortage of psychiatrists in the United States. The number of people in need of treatment is growing more quickly than the number of psychiatrists available. Some patients have waited for months to see a psychiatrist. This is even worse for the poorer groups that have less access to psychiatrists.

In order to address the shortage of psychiatrists Health care providers are implementing innovative strategies to ensure that all patients receive the assistance they require. Some of these include teaming with primary care doctors and using the telehealth method to treat patients. Moreover, some insurance companies have begun to offer telehealth services for their members.

After completing medical school, psychiatrists who are aspiring must complete four years of residency training. During their residency, they acquire the necessary knowledge to treat a variety of mental health issues. Some psychiatric residency residents choose to specialize in a specific area of medicine. For example, they may choose to work with patients with both medical and psychiatric issues.

Psychiatrists must have excellent ability to think critically in order to identify the cause of their patients behavior. They must review professional notes and observe their patients to comprehend their condition. Psychiatrists must also be able to communicate effectively with their patients. They must be able answer questions and explain complex information in a way that is easy to comprehend. Psychologists need to keep accurate and detailed notes on their patients' progress and how they react to medications.
